A freestanding git repository with a work tree consists of a set of refs (that includes your local branches in refs/heads, tags in refs/tags, and remote tracking branches refs/remotes but not limited to these three categories. Anything under refs/ is a ref by definition, and it includes the stash), reflogs, the index, HEAD (which is typically a pointer into refs/heads/ somewhere but can directly be pointing at a commit), and an object store. An object store of a repository that is not corrupt contains all objects that are reachable from refs, reflogs, the index and the HEAD, and "gc --prune" will remove everything else. So the answer to the question in your later part of the message is that: - FETCH_HEAD, ORIG_HEAD and MERGE_HEAD do not protect anything from getting pruned; - Objects that are not reachable from the tip of branches will remain in the object store after pruning, if they are reachable from non-branch refs (e.g. tags and the stash), reflogs, or the index.
